ul#icons {margin: 0; padding: 0;}
ul#icons li {margin: 2px; position: relative; padding: 4px 0; cursor: pointer; float: left;  list-style: none;}
ul#icons span.ui-icon {float: left; margin: 0 4px;}
label { font-size: 11px; color: #9e9e90; }
input.text { margin-bottom:2px; width:95%; padding: .2em; background-color: #000000;}
select { width:95%; padding: 0.2em; background: #000000; }
option { padding: 0em; background-color: #000000; font-size: 10px; }

.formLayer
{
    visibility:hidden;
    border:none;
    padding:10px;
}

.termsLayer
{
    visibility:hidden;
    border:none;
    padding:10px;
    font-size: 11px;
}

.rowLayer
{
    width:100%;
    overflow:hidden;
    padding-bottom:3px;
    height:40px;
}

.loginLayer
{
    visibility:hidden;
    width: 100px;
    border:none;
    padding:0px;
}

.signupText
{
    height:12px;
    font-size:11px;
    color: #9e9e90;
}

.tooltipMessage
{
    padding-top: 13px;
    padding-left: 5px;
    font-size:9px;
    color: #9e9e90;
    display:none;
}

.tooltipIcon
{
    padding-top: 13px;
    padding-left: 5px;
    font-size:9px;
    color: #9e9e90;
    display:none;
}

#infoTips
{
    height:20px;
    padding-top: 5px;
    padding-bottom: 8px;
}

#infoTips td
{
    font-size:11px;
    color: #c4d4f0;
}

.tip
{
	display: none;
	vertical-align: middle;
}

#validateTips
{
	color: #c4d4f0;
	font-size: 11px;
	height: 10px;
}